MentalRiskES: A New Corpus for Early Detection of Mental Disorders in Spanish
Alba María Mármol Romero, Adrián Moreno-Muñoz, Flor Miriam Plaza-Del-Arco, M. Dolores Molina-González, Arturo Montejo-Ráez
Abstract
With mental health issues on the rise on the Web, especially among young people, there is a growing need for effective identification and intervention. In this paper, we introduce a new open-sourced corpus for the early detection of mental disorders in Spanish, focusing on eating disorders, depression, and anxiety. It consists of user messages posted on groups within the Telegram message platform and contains over 1,300 subjects with more than 45,000 messages posted in different public Telegram groups. This corpus has been manually annotated via crowdsourcing and is prepared for its use in several Natural Language Processing tasks including text classification and regression tasks. The samples in the corpus include both text and time data. To provide a benchmark for future research, we conduct experiments on text classification and regression by using state-of-the-art transformer-based models.
